#ec5844 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ec5844 is composed of 92.5% red, 34.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 71.2%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 7.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 59.6%. #ec5844 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b088 with #d90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#ec5844 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ec5844 has RGB values of R:236, G:88,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.71,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15489092.

Shades and Tints of #ec5844
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090201 is the darkest color, while #fef7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ec5844
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9493 is the less saturated color, while #fc4c34 is the most saturated one.
